  • IBM Unveils World’s First Sub-1 Nanometer Chip Technology

    IBM has announced a major breakthrough in semiconductor technology with the introduction of the world’s first sub-1 nanometer (0.7 nm or 7 angstrom) nanometer chip technology. The innovation marks a significant advancement for the semiconductor industry as it pushes beyond the conventional limits of chip scaling.

  • The Global Space Division Multiplexing Devices Market is rapidly gaining attention as communication networks worldwide seek innovative solutions to manage unprecedented data growth. The increasing demand for high-speed internet connectivity, cloud computing services, artificial intelligence applications, and data-intensive technologies has placed significant pressure on existing network infrastructures. As traditional optical communication methods approach their capacity limits, Space Division Multiplexing (SDM) technology is emerging as a transformative solution capable of dramatically increasing data transmission capabilities.

    Space Division Multiplexing devices enable multiple spatial channels to transmit information simultaneously within a single optical fiber system. This capability significantly enhances bandwidth utilization while reducing the need for extensive infrastructure expansion. The technology is becoming increasingly important for telecommunications providers, data center operators, research institutions, and government agencies seeking scalable and cost-effective networking solutions.

    Space Division Multiplexing represents a significant advancement in optical communications. Unlike conventional multiplexing techniques that separate data streams through wavelength or time allocation, SDM utilizes multiple spatial paths within the same fiber structure.

    This innovation allows communication networks to support substantially greater transmission capacity without requiring additional fiber deployment. Technologies such as multicore fibers, few-mode fibers, and advanced multiplexers form the foundation of SDM systems.

    As global digital transformation accelerates, SDM technology is increasingly viewed as a critical enabler of next-generation communication infrastructure.
